About the role
As a Correctional CMA / AA, you will work alongside correctional officers and other medical professionals to provide care to individuals in residence. This role operates within a controlled environment where security is a top priority. You will assist physicians and other healthcare professionals with examinations, take patient histories, record vital signs, and support administrative tasks. This is a unique position where you can make a difference to a diverse population of patients with complex medical needs. New graduates are encouraged to apply—we provide training in the field of correctional healthcare.
Responsibilities
- Clinical Duties
- Perform routine blood drawing procedures as applicable by licensure
- Take and document vital signs, height, and weight; assist with PPDs and EKGs as required
- Assist with examinations and/or treatments as needed; report all changes in patients’ conditions
- Assist with patient hygiene, ambulation, and dressing changes
- Administrative Duties
- Receive and route visitors, inquiries, and issues to the appropriate staff
- Transmit correspondence and medical records via mail, email, or fax
- Perform various clerical and administrative functions, including ordering and maintaining an inventory of supplies
- Sort and distribute all mail and interoffice correspondence
- Perform bookkeeping duties, such as preparation of expense reports and maintaining petty cash and receipts
- Transmit and maintain all medical claims, subpoenas, and/or medical record requests as required
- Assist with staff scheduling and coordinate all meetings
- Prepare and maintain monthly reporting and statistical data as required
- Gather and maintain documentation required for all accreditation surveys
- Notify critical information to the next level of management that may impact client/vendor relations or patient care
Requirements
- CMA Certification—completion of an accredited medical assisting program
- High school diploma or equivalent (GED)
- Able to obtain BLS/CPR Certification (AHA required)
- Office Lab Assistant License (for Nevada only)
- Able to maintain confidentiality of all proprietary and/or confidential information
- Display integrity, professionalism, and adherence to a Code of Conduct
- Comply with all facility correctional healthcare policies, procedures, and legal requirements
- Must pass the facility’s criminal background check and drug screening
Physical Capabilities
- Ability to stand for long periods
- Lift and move patients (up to 50 pounds)
- Bend, squat, reach, push, pull, and walk significant distances
- Perform physically demanding tasks like CPR
- Maintain good balance and endurance throughout a shift
